Is It Possible To Reline Pipes That Have Bends In Them?

Yes trenchless pipe relining is an excellent, no-dig method to repair broken pipes with bends within their pipe. Relining the pipe creates an entirely new pipe inside that pipe. This means you don’t need to take out the old pipe and can replace it without digging into your driveway or yard.

The difficulty of a pipe relining job gets more difficult with more bends within the pipe. Our team of experts have replaced many sewer line pipes with bends in them.

Although it’s a challenge, it’s not impossible and we’ve got the knowledge and expertise to get the job completed right.

Will Sliplining Stop Roots From Trees From Entering Pipes?

Yes, trenchless pipe relining solutions could help in stopping tree roots from entering your sewer. Sliplining is the job process of creating a new pipe inside the old one, and helps close any cracks or openings that might allow tree roots to enter.

Additionally, regular maintenance and cleaning of your drainage system can assist in stopping tree roots from entering.

What’s the Difference Between Pipe Relining And Pipe Replacement?

Pipe relining allows for the creation of a brand new pipe inside an old one, and pipe replacement is a process that breaks the old pipe and replaces it with a brand new one.

Pipe relining tends to be more non-invasive and could be a more affordable option than pipe replacement. Speak to an expert regarding your particular needs to figure out which solution will work best for you.

Does Pipe Relining Reduce The Pipe Flow?

There is usually no decrease in the flow of pipes as a result of pipe relining. Relining pipes is often a way to increase your flow that flows through the pipe since it creates the new smooth surface for water to travel through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been Around?

Pipe relining was used for many years, with the first documented case was in 1854. However, it wasn’t until the early 2000s that it was beginning to become more commonplace.

The technology of pipe relining is utilised all over the world as an efficient solution to fix leaky or damaged pipes without the need to tear them out and replace them entirely. There are various kinds of pipe relining services that can be used according to the type of pipe used and the severity in the extent of damage.

For instance, there’s spot pipe relining Valley Heights, which is utilised for leaks of a small size, as well as structural pipe relining, that is utilised for more serious damage. Whichever type of pipe relining is used in the process, the goal is the same: fixing the pipe without replacing it in totality.

This option that doesn’t require digging can reduce time and cost as well as it’s also a more sustainable option than replacing the pipe.
